SecurityTokenProvider.CancelTokenCoreAsync(TimeSpan, SecurityToken) Metoda

Definicja

Anuluje token zabezpieczający.

protected:
 virtual System::Threading::Tasks::Task ^ CancelTokenCoreAsync(TimeSpan timeout, System::IdentityModel::Tokens::SecurityToken ^ token);
protected virtual System.Threading.Tasks.Task CancelTokenCoreAsync (TimeSpan timeout, System.IdentityModel.Tokens.SecurityToken token);
abstract member CancelTokenCoreAsync : TimeSpan * System.IdentityModel.Tokens.SecurityToken -> System.Threading.Tasks.Task
override this.CancelTokenCoreAsync : TimeSpan * System.IdentityModel.Tokens.SecurityToken -> System.Threading.Tasks.Task
Protected Overridable Function CancelTokenCoreAsync (timeout As TimeSpan, token As SecurityToken) As Task

Parametry

timeout
TimeSpan

Element TimeSpan określający wartość limitu czasu komunikatu, który anuluje token zabezpieczający.

token
SecurityToken

Element SecurityToken do anulowania.

Zwraca

Task

Element Task reprezentujący operację anulowania tokenu asynchronicznego.

Uwagi

Token zabezpieczający, który można anulować, taki jak wystawiony, umożliwia klientowi, który zażądał tokenu zabezpieczającego, aby anulować go po zakończeniu.

Metoda CancelTokenAsync wywołuje CancelTokenCoreAsync metodę.

CancelTokenCoreAsync Gdy metoda jest zastępowana, a token zabezpieczający przekazany do parametru tokenu nie może zostać anulowany, należy zgłosić SecurityTokenException wyjątek.

Dotyczy